#26c444 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#26c444 is composed of 14.9% red, 76.9% green and 26.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 80.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 65.3% yellow and 23.1% black. It has a hue angle of 131.4 degrees, a saturation of 67.5% and a lightness of 45.9%. #26c444 color hex could be obtained by blending #4cff88 with #008900. Closest websafe color is: #33cc33.

Shades and Tints of #26c444
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030f05 is the darkest color, while #fefffe is the lightest one.
